About The Position

Under the supervision of the RFC Membership and Customer Service Supervisor or the RFC Manager, this position requires comprehensive knowledge of all aspects of RFC operations. The primary responsibilities include delivering outstanding customer service, addressing, and resolving customer complaints or issues, enforcing facility policies, performing accurate data entry, and documenting daily events. Serve as the Manager on Duty in the absence of the Management team. Strong verbal and written communication skills are essential, as is the ability to respond effectively to emergency situations. This role supports the mission of the H-F Park District: "To enhance the quality of life through diverse recreational opportunities, facilities and parks while caring for the environment."
